“Why do we need inspections?” you might wonder. Inspections help identify potential issues before they become costly problems. They also ensure compliance with industry standards and regulations.
Before starting any project, familiarize yourself with local regulations. Each state or region has specific requirements regarding structural steel inspection. “I had no idea regulations varied so much!” a colleague once said. It’s true; knowing the rules is essential.
“How do I find a good inspector?” This is a common question. Look for inspectors with relevant certifications and experience. They should not only understand structural steel but also be familiar with local codes. A qualified inspector will help ensure that your project meets all requirements.

Maintain detailed records of all inspections. This documentation could be useful later. “What if we get audited?” a project manager asked me once. If you have thorough records, you’ll be well-prepared.
Effective communication is key. Ensure that everyone involved in the project understands the inspection requirements. "Does everyone know their role?" you might ask. Regular meetings can help keep everyone aligned. Share findings and updates immediately. This transparency can prevent misunderstandings.
If you’ve undergone steel inspections before, review those experiences. “What went well last time?” or “What could have gone better?” are questions worth considering. Continuous improvement can help streamline future inspections.
